The Advantages of Candlelight Yoga

Why should you dim the lights and light a candle before you unroll your yoga mat? The benefits extend far beyond the superficial. Learn these few compelling reasons to incorporate candlelight into your practice:

Relaxation:

The soft luminescence of candlelight soothes the mind and relaxes the body, fostering a sense of peace and calmness.

Stress Mitigation:

Concentrating on the here and now and letting go of outside concerns, candlelight yoga can help mitigate stress and anxiety.

Mindfulness:

Undertaking yoga in a dimly lit room fosters mindfulness, making you more conscious of your breathing, sensations, and emotional state.

Flexibility:

The slow-moving manner of candlelight yoga offers the chance to gently stretch and loosen up, enhancing flexibility and maneuverability over time.

 

How to Set Up for Candlelight Yoga at Home

Transforming your living space into a tranquil yoga haven doesn't have to be complicated. Here's a simple guide to get you started:

Choosing the Right Space and Time

Find a quiet corner where you won't be disturbed, preferably facing east or with an eastward view. Set aside a time when you can ensure peace and privacy, perhaps at dawn or dusk for an added dose of natural calm.

Selecting Suitable Candles

When it comes to candles for your practice, simplicity is key. Opt for unscented candles to avoid overwhelming your senses and to maintain focus on your breath and movement. Pillar or tealight candles are excellent choices due to their stability and long-lasting glow. However, it's essential to prioritize safety and cleanliness. Choose candles made from natural wax, such as premium coconut wax, housed in clear glass vessels for a clean burn and a touch of sophistication. Candlelight Yoga Poses and Sequences

Candlelight yoga sequences are designed to be gentle, inviting you to unwind and release the stress of the day. Here are some poses and sequences to get you started:

Gentle Stretches and Poses Suitable for Relaxation

Begin with easy seated poses like Sukhasana (Easy Pose) or Balasana (Child's Pose) to ground your energy. Move into gentle forward folds like Upavistha Konasana (Wide-Legged Seated Forward Bend) for a soothing stretch.

Flow Sequences for a Meditative Practice

Try a slow Vinyasa flow where you linger in each movement, synced with your breath. Surya Namaskars (Sun Salutations) at a leisurely pace are also a wonderful way to sync mind, body, and soul.

Breathing Exercises to Deepen the Experience

Pranayama, or breathwork, is key to the depth of your candlelight practice. Incorporate techniques like Nadi Shodhana (Alternate Nostril Breathing) and Bhramari (Bee Breath) for a profound addition to your session.

 

Enhancing the Experience

The beauty of candlelight yoga is the space it provides for personalization. Here are some ideas for enhancing your practice:

Incorporating Meditation or Visualization Techniques

After your physical practice, seat yourself comfortably and indulge in a few minutes of meditation. You can also include a guided visualization, allowing the soft light to weave through the scenes you create in your mind's eye.

Using Props Like Blankets or Bolsters

Props support your practice, especially in the twilight of candlelight where balance can be more challenging. Use a blanket or bolster to perfect your postures and sink deeper into relaxation.

Experimenting with Different Candle Placements for Ambiance

Get creative with your candle placements. Try placing a few on the ground around your mat, or use reflective surfaces like mirrors to amplify their glow.
